Update: It appears that the issue I am/was having with my ThinkPad W520
hanging during boot is likely not related to udev.  The short answer for
me was: turn off Intel Virtualization Technology in BIOS.
I will be doing testing this weekend to attempt to isolate the offending
module.

Thanks for all the help I got in #udev.  Kay's suggestion to enable
debugging and turn off asynchronous processing helped me to eliminate
udev as the source of the failure.
